We went to the Venus hotel to discover Louxor our own way, outside the stereotyped tourism. The staff advised us on how to find our way and how to feel confortable in this busy and over-touristic city. His recommendations, and the few arabic words he teaches us made a big difference and helped make our overall experience very positive. We enjoyed the Egyptian food served at the hostel’s restaurant. We also had filling breakfast, with fresh juice and minute made omelette by the attentive chef. The place is very busy during the late day and quiet at night and in the morning hours. The room had a balcony from where we watched the amazing activity in the street and the souk (local market). Going thru the “Bazar” next door, it took us 10 min to reach the Nile. We are travelling with our dog and were happy to find people who are real dog’s lovers. We’ll go there again !

Looking for a hostel?

Budget travellers know that there is no better way to make the most of their trip than by staying at a hostel: save money for exploring during the day, and swap stories with fellow backpackers in the shared kitchen or bar in the evening. Dorm-style bedrooms with shared bathrooms are standard hostel fare, but private rooms are also available for those willing to pay a bit more.
